The Employees Social Security Act 1969 (Act 4) stipulates an actuarial review should be carried out at intervals of at least every five years or at such other times as the Minister of Human Resources may consider necessary. The ILO carried out the eleventh actuarial valuation as of 31 December 2019 and the next (twelfth) actuarial valuation will take place as of 31 December 2024.
The project is focused around three key outcomes. Firstly, the undertaking and delivery of the actuarial valuations for four schemes. Full actuarial valuation reports including key results and recommendations, and reference to compliance with ILO Convention 102 will be completed. Secondly, a range of policy and technical support to PERKESO on extension of coverage (of existing schemes and proposed new schemes), policy and financing reform and management issues will be provided. Finally, there will be a strong focus on capacity building including the delivery of the actuarial models for the different benefit schemes to allow PERKESO to carry out actuarial analysis on their own plus tailored training on actuarial, financing, risk management and extension of coverage issues.
These Terms of Reference refer to the work related to the preparation of the valuation of the Employment Insurance (UI) Scheme (Act 800) as of 31 December 2025. This will the second actuarial valuation of this scheme; the first valuation was carried out by another organisation.
To carry out this work, the Modelling Actuary will work closely with the Senior Actuary as well as with the Chief Technical Advisor (CTA) and Head of the Regional Actuarial Services Unit in Bangkok and PERKESO actuarial staff. The work includes the following elements:
This document therefore sets out the Terms of Reference for the Modelling Actuary for this work.
The Expert will carry out the following activities summarised as Preparatory work for the actuarial valuation of the Employment Insurance Scheme (Act 800) and including:
